The holidays in New York City are synonymous with extravagant window displays along the city's avenues. Cheryl McGinnis, Cheddar's Senior Art Correspondent, explains the significance of the one-of-a-kind window piece on display at the Prow Art Space in the Flatiron Building.
Prow and Sprint partnered with students at FIT to create the window display. McGinnis says it represents the beauty and welcoming nature of the holidays.
McGinnis also discusses the history of window displays in New York City. She says that they're meant to create an aura of wonder even for people who may not be able to buy the products inside the store.
